logo

Output 3a30a83951489304c37327f88c92aeb747b8394c0f1f81c8773606b0c438066d:1

value
27053145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819c555dad385a5e07ab4d8c7f406ab34ad1c1a0 OP_EQUAL
address
3DWLNXeKQZGyes5iYPsceRK7dwaiGt7HhS
transaction
3a30a83951489304c37327f88c92aeb747b8394c0f1f81c8773606b0c438066d